Bolivar Intermediate Sch. is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Bolivar, Polk County. The school has 598 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Bolivar R-I school district. It serves grades 3โ5 in a small-town setting. The school employs 45.5 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 13.1:1. 47% of students are proficient in reading. 48% are proficient in maths. Bolivar Intermediate Sch. enrolls 598 students across grades 3โ5. The student body is 47% male and 53% female. A teaching staff of 45.5 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 13.1: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 87% White, 5.9% Two or more races and 5% Hispanic or Latino.

313 of the school's 598 students (52%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 228 qualify for free lunch and 85 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Bolivar Intermediate Sch. is located in a small-town setting (NCES locale: Town, Distant).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district MO-40, state senate district 28, state house district 128.
Bolivar Intermediate Sch. is one of 5 schools in BOLIVAR R-I, based in BOLIVAR, Missouri. The district serves 2,725 students district-wide and employs 211 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 598 students, Bolivar Intermediate Sch. is close to the district average of about 545 students per school.
